PoC Exploit for Critical Fortra FileCatalyst Flaw Published
The vulnerability allows attackers to create administrative user accounts, modify and delete data in the application database, and potentially gain full control of vulnerable systems.

Malicious NPM Package Targets AWS Users to Deploy Backdoor
ReversingLabs researchers discovered a suspicious package on npm called legacyreact-aws-s3-typescript. They found that the package contained a post-install script that downloaded and executed a simple backdoor.
